PM hints at giving up social media, sets netizens buzzing

NEW DELHI: PM Narendra Modi, the biggest social media draw in India and one of the biggest in the world, sprang a surprise with this tweet at 8.56pm on Monday: “This Sunday, thinking of giving up my social media accounts on Facebook, Twitter, Instagram and YouTube. Will keep you posted.”

The post sparked intense speculation as to why Modi, who’s perfected the art of communicating directly with people – almost bypassing or ‘disintermediating’ traditional mainstream media – should be contemplating such a step.

The absence of an official explanation spawned an instant industry of theories. BJP functionaries offered some likely reasons like Modi going for a ‘digital detox’ or being upset about spread of “hatred, fake news and rumours” on social media platforms fuelling Delhi’s communal riots
